#2d6b59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d6b59 is composed of 17.6% red, 42%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.8%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 162.6 degrees, a saturation of 40.8% and a lightness of 29.8%. #2d6b59 color hex could be obtained by blending #5ad6b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#2d6b59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a09 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d6b59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4e4d is the less saturated color, while #04946a is the most saturated one.
